Analysis

The most recent figure for percentage of qualified teachers in secondary education, male in Eswatini is 44.4%, measured in 2022. That is the lowest value across all 5 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 42.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, percentage of qualified teachers in secondary education, male in Eswatini peaked at 76.8% in 2013 and was at its lowest, 44.4%, in 2022.

Eswatini ranks 88th of 93 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

Percentage of qualified teachers in secondary education, male in Eswatini, year by year

Annual values for Percentage of qualified teachers in secondary education, male (%) in Eswatini, 2013 to 2022.
Year % Change
2013 76.8%
2014 76.0% -1.0%
2015 73.8% -3.0%
2016 74.8% +1.4%
2022 44.4% -40.6%
